Montgomery County Animal Care and Control Hosts Howl-O-Ween Event
Montgomery County, TN – Montgomery County Animal Care and Control will host its first annual Howl-O-Ween Tricks Fur Treats Extravaganza on Saturday, October 24th, from 1:00pm to 4:00pm at their facility located at 616 North Spring Street.
This first time event will event will foster community outreach and public awareness, give booth participants the ability to showcase their businesses and organizations, and help the animals at MCAC at the same time!

Donate blood with the Red Cross in October
October is Breast Cancer Awareness Month
Support cancer patients and others needing blood
Clarksville, TN – During Breast Cancer Awareness Month this October, the American Red Cross encourages eligible donors to give blood to support cancer patients and others needing blood products.
According to the American Cancer Society, breast cancer is the second most common cancer among women in the U.S., with one in eight developing invasive breast cancer in her lifetime. Breast cancer patients may need blood products during chemotherapy, mastectomy surgery or treatment of complications.

Montgomery County Sheriff’s Office announces Domestic Violence Awareness Event set for Saturday, October 10th
Clarksville, TN – The 14th Annual Domestic Violence Awareness Event will be held Saturday, October 10th from 11:00am– 2:00pm at the Civic Hall at Veterans Plaza. Remember My Name is dedicated to mothers and children who have lost their lives from domestic violence.
Red wooden silhouettes will be on display throughout the event. Each silhouette represents a man, woman or child who died from domestic violence, along with their story. Some family members of victims will be there to commemorate their loved ones. «Read the rest of this article»
